I have gone to HBU for 3 years now and wouldn't change a thing! I came to a small campus knowing that I would have a small class size and a better community. The professors are very friendly and helpful and will go out of their way to help you. When you live on campus you can really plug yourself into clubs or organizations and I would recommend that to any student looking to come to HBU. The education program at HBU is great. I love it. You have field work basically every semester once you get into the education program so you can really experience schools and how they work. I am confident that I will find a job after graduation because HBU has such a good reputation to the surrounding school districts. (Katy ISD, HISD, ETC.) I really do like being at HBU! I would recommend any students looking for a community in college and looking for a great hands-on curriculum to go to HBU!
